Charlie Shavers's partial-chorus trumpet solo is the second and final solo on this reading of the Warren standard. Shavers takes the 2nd half of the chorus following Flip Phillips over the 36-bar AABA' form at 152 BPM in G, building in intensity to add dramatic flair to the arrangement. His bright trumpet picks up the thread from Phillips's warmer tenor, and together the two horn solos create a miniature narrative arc that leads back to Billie Holiday's vocal for the song's conclusion.
Charlie Shavers was 31 to 32 years old at the time.
